For my next training, I chose to practice some painting in Photoshop. I’m already familiar with digital painting in other programs such as Clip Studio and Procreate, so I wanted to see how my skills would translate.

I was tasked to paint the provided reference, which was a red tea pot. I first started by painting the silhouette of the tea pot, added the shadows, highlights, and details. I did not spend too much time cleaning up since this was just practice.

I was next tasked with finding my own reference and paint it using what I had learned. I decided to choose a simple black and white image of a vulture I found on Pixabay. I find it easier to paint in black and white rather than color. The first image is the reference, the second image is the painting.

This was definitely my favorite training project and I’m pleased with what I created. I hope to do more paintings and illustrations like these in future projects.

I had been tasked to create a background design for the collab lab computers, like the ones in the design lab. I was instructed to keep the theme interesting but not too distracting from the lists of tasks listed.

I first developed a simple style with a textured gradient found through Adobe Stock images. I wanted the background to feel uniform, so I adjusted the text bubbles to match the colors. I created 4 different versions to give my director a variety of options.


Design lab computer background
My examples for the collab lab computer background

I was happy with the results, however it wasn’t what we were quiet looking for. The background was too simple and the text bubbles were not contrasting enough. I was tasked into finding a background with more movement and to revert the text bubble colors to black text and white background.

I went back onto Adobe Stock images to find an abstract piece that was more visually interesting. I came upon the one shown below and went ahead and made edits accordingly. I went with just 2 variations this time since I was given specific instructions on what needed adjusting.


My updated versions

I’m much happier with the result of this version. I feel the overall design is much more contrasting and visually appealing. I have not heard from my art director yet, so I’m currently waiting on feedback.
